Miyakojima City Traditional Crafts Center

Miyakojima City Traditional Crafts Center

宮古島市伝統工芸館

Okinawa

The Miyakojima City Traditional Crafts Center showcases the unique traditional crafts of Miyako Island, including textiles and pottery. Visitors can learn about the local artisans and even participate in workshops to create their own crafts.

Why it's hidden

Many travelers focus on the beaches and natural scenery, overlooking the rich cultural experiences available.
